What does the FILTER clause do when used with aggregate functions in SQL?

Key points

  • The FILTER clause applies a per-aggregate WHERE condition.
  • It helps avoid the use of multiple subqueries for filtering.
  • Each aggregate function can have its own specific predicate.
  • This enhances efficiency in SQL queries.
